Christmas at Gaylord Palms Creates Flurries in Florida!

In our family, attending the Gaylord Palms Christmas event is a tradition we treasure. And just like everything else in 2020, Christmas at Gaylord Palms is a little different this year. Gaylord Palms is well known for their ICE! displays each year. To create these incredible ice sculptures, international artists travel months in advance to begin their work. With travel restrictions this year, they weren’t able to create ICE! So instead, Gaylord Palms created a brand new experience with “I Love Christmas Movies!” Keep reading for everything you can find at Christmas at Gaylord Palms.

Snow Factory Brings Flurries to Florida

When you live in Florida, you sometimes have to pretend to create seasons. And Christmas is no different! But at Gaylord Palms Christmas, you can experience Snow Factory with flurries in Florida. In fact, not only can you see some flurries, but you can throw snowballs and even go snow tubing. That’s not something you get to do every day in Florida.

Snow Factory is a brand new experience this year. It includes Snow Flow Mountain, which was my kid’s absolute favorite part of Christmas at Gaylord Palms. What is it? It’s where you and your family can slide through factory conveyor belts that have frozen solid and ride on tubes down a thrilling plummet slide or hilly ice coaster. And our family loved battling it out at the Snowball Build and Blast! This friendly competition allows guests to build and toss real snowballs to boost the power of snowmaking machines. We had so much fun throwing snowballs as a family!
